pmbootstrap 3.1.0 is out!
> This release allows using pmbootstrap with Alpine 3.21 / pmOS v24.12, adds support for ppc64le, adds code to install keyboard configuration based on chosen locale and has a bunch of fixes. Thanks to everybody who contributed!
